The Process of Water Heater Installation Spanish Fork

The process of water heater installation in Spanish Fork begins with selecting the right type and size of water heater for your home. The most popular residential water heaters include tankless, electric, and gas water heaters. Tankless units are more efficient, as they only turn on when a hot water demand is detected, while electric and gas water heaters are more affordable. The next step is determining the unit size you need- generally, a 30-40-gallon tank is suitable for a family of 3-4, while larger tank sizes up to 120 gallons are available for larger homes.

Once you have chosen the right size and type of unit, the next step is connecting the water heater to the existing plumbing system in your home. This involves selecting the proper piping and water lines and ensuring they are correctly connected to the water heater.
